Burger King marketer goes to McCann Erickson

Former Burger King marketing director for Europe David Kisilevsky is to join advertising agency McCann Erickson in a European role.

Kisilevsky, who worked at Leo Burnett for many years, will be sub regional director for central and eastern Europe.

He is tasked with developing greater collaboration between both regional offices and clients, whilst providing leadership oversight and support across CEE which the agency sees as having significant growth potential for the agency.

Kisilevsky announced his departure from Burger King at the end of last month. He has yet to be replaced.

Kisilevsky held the role of vice president of marketing for EMEA since 2008, having joined Burger King from Leo Burnett in 2006. His departure came weeks after Natalia Franco was named as Burger King’s chief marketing officer, based in the company’s Miami headquarters.
